Asset Manager
Yilgarn Region | 8&6 Roster | Iron Ore Restart Project
TSS are delighted to be partnering with Yilgarn Iron on the restart of their Yilgarn Hub — a portfolio of historic iron ore assets recently acquired from Mineral Resources. The operation spans Koolyanobbing, Windarling and Parker Range, with mining and processing delivered by specialist contractors under Yilgarn's management.
About the Role
We're seeking an experienced Asset Manager to oversee the lifecycle management of approximately $500 million worth of fixed and mobile assets across the Yilgarn Hub. This is a site-based role on an 8&6 roster, supporting day-to-day operations while providing structured oversight of asset performance, utilisation and care.
You'll be responsible for ensuring Yilgarn's assets are maintained to standard, tracked through their lifecycle, and replaced or refurbished when required. The role also involves managing contractor accountability — ensuring equipment is operated responsibly and aligned with Yilgarn's commercial and operational expectations.
